  Hi James,

  if you for these transactions financial postings are also activated. then
  you can go to that posting account (from inventory postings form). now go
to
  chart of account , select the account and then go to the dimension tab and
  select the mandatory dimension/ "To be filled in"

      Try this:

         InventTrans inventtrans;
         ;
         select count(RecID) from inventtrans where inventtras.transtype==3;
           info(int2str(inventTrans.RecID));

      The number of records is then stored in inventTrans.RecID.
      Also, please consider using enums instead of numbers. Here, you ought
to
      write InventTransType::Purch instead of 3. It makes the code a lotmore
      readable!
